EPA Violations

  • 322 total violations across Brooksville
  • 0 health-based violations
  • 7 of 7 ZIP codes have violations
  • 0 ZIP codes exceed EPA lead action level

Top Contaminants

Contaminant Violations ZIPs
Consumer Confidence Report Rule 168 7
Total Coliform 63 7
Surface Water Treatment Rule 35 7
Total Trihalomethanes (TTHM) 21 7
Haloacetic Acids (HAA5) 14 7

Is Brooksville water safe to drink?

Brooksville has an average water safety score of 77/100 (B). Water quality varies by neighborhood — no ZIP codes currently exceed EPA lead limits. Always check your specific ZIP code.
